The 200G QSFP-DD 2×CWDM4 Optical Transceiver Module is a high-density optical solution designed to provide dual 100Gbps Ethernet connectivity over single-mode fiber. Based on two independent 100GBASE-CWDM4 optical links, the module converts eight 25Gb/s NRZ electrical lanes into eight CWDM optical channels and delivers transmission distances up to 2km through G.652 single-mode fiber. With dual Duplex LC interfaces, it enables flexible deployment of 2×100G connections in modern data center and enterprise network environments.
Designed in the QSFP-DD form factor, this transceiver supports high port density while maintaining efficient power consumption and thermal performance. It integrates DFB laser transmitters, PIN photodetector receivers, TX/RX CDR circuits with bypass capability, and CMIS V4.0 management functions to ensure stable high-speed operation. Compliant with QSFP-DD MSA and CWDM4 MSA specifications, it is an ideal choice for cloud data centers, high-performance computing networks, and next-generation optical infrastructure requiring scalable 200G connectivity.
200G QSFP-DD 2×CWDM4 Optical Transceiver Module Specification
| Form Factor | QSFP-DD |
|---|---|
| Data Rate | 200Gbps |
| Ethernet Standard | 2×100GBASE-CWDM4 Ethernet |
| Fiber Type | Single-Mode Fiber (SMF) |
| Fiber Compatibility | G.652 SMF |
| Maximum Distance | Up to 2km |
| Optical Technology | CWDM4 |
| Optical Channels | 8 CWDM Optical Channels |
| Optical Configuration | 2 Independent 100G Links |
| Electrical Interface | 8 × 25Gb/s NRZ (Supports 8 × 10Gb/s) |
| Modulation Format | NRZ |
| Transmitter Type | DFB Laser Array |
| Receiver Type | PIN Photodetector Array |
| Optical Connector | Dual Duplex LC |
| CDR Function | Integrated TX/RX CDR with Bypass Support |
| Power Supply | Single +3.3V |
| Maximum Power Consumption | ≤6.5W |
| Digital Monitoring | DDM Supported |
| Management Interface | CMIS V4.0 |
| Hot Plug Capability | Yes |

What does 2×CWDM4 mean in this 200G QSFP-DD module?
2×CWDM4 means the module integrates two independent 100G CWDM4 optical links inside a single QSFP-DD package. Each CWDM4 link uses four CWDM wavelengths to achieve 100Gbps transmission, providing a total aggregate bandwidth of 200Gbps.
What fiber type is required for this transceiver?
This module is designed for single-mode fiber (SMF), typically G.652 fiber. The Dual Duplex LC interfaces allow direct connection to standard duplex single-mode fiber cabling systems used in data centers and enterprise networks.
What is the advantage of using a QSFP-DD form factor for 200G applications?
QSFP-DD provides higher port density compared with traditional QSFP form factors by supporting eight electrical lanes. It allows network operators to deploy higher bandwidth solutions while maximizing switch panel space and improving overall infrastructure efficiency.
Can this module be used as two separate 100G connections?
Yes. The module is designed with two independent 100GBASE-CWDM4 optical interfaces. Each optical link can operate separately through its own Duplex LC connection, allowing flexible deployment of dual 100G connections.
Does this module support digital monitoring?
Yes. The transceiver supports Digital Diagnostic Monitoring (DDM) through the CMIS V4.0 management interface, enabling monitoring of key operating parameters such as temperature, voltage, and optical power.
